Courses on topics of international law librarianship and legal information have been a primary feature of IALL's educational program since 1966. The courses have been held at prominent institutions throughout the world at intervals of one to three years, and have been offered annually since 1993. Throughout its history, the International Journal of Legal Information has published advance information and reports on the courses, as well as selected papers. Since 1994, full proceedings from the courses have usually been published in the Journal. Proceedings from some courses, as well as from other IALL meetings and programs, have been published separately.(1) Listed below are the titles, locations and dates for the twenty-one courses offered through 2002:
